Basalt fiber composite reinforcement is a material that is gaining popularity in the construction industry due to its high strength and durability. Basalt fiber is a natural material that is derived from volcanic rock, making it an environmentally friendly option for reinforcement in various construction applications. One of the key areas where basalt fiber composite reinforcement is being used is in road construction.

Road construction is a critical aspect of infrastructure development, and the use of basalt fiber composite reinforcement can help improve the longevity and performance of roads. Basalt fiber offers several advantages over traditional reinforcement materials such as steel, including higher tensile strength, corrosion resistance, and lower weight. These properties make basalt fiber an ideal choice for reinforcing concrete and asphalt in road construction projects.

Chopped basalt fiber is a common form of basalt fiber used in road construction. This type of fiber is produced by chopping continuous basalt fibers into short lengths, which are then mixed with concrete or asphalt to enhance their mechanical properties. Chopped basalt fiber can improve the tensile strength, flexural strength, and impact resistance of road surfaces, making them more durable and resistant to cracking and deformation.

Another advantage of basalt fiber composite reinforcement is its resistance to corrosion. Unlike steel reinforcement, which can corrode over time due to exposure to moisture and Chemicals, basalt fiber is inert and does not rust or degrade. This makes basalt fiber an ideal choice for reinforcing structures in harsh environments or areas with high Levels of moisture or chemical exposure.
